首页 > 数据库 > mysql教程 > mysql权限管理,一个非db管理员创建mysql的做法_MySQL

mysql权限管理,一个非db管理员创建mysql的做法_MySQL

WBOYWBOYWBOYWBOYWBOYWBOYWBOYWBOYWBOYWBOYWBOYWBOYWB
发布: 2016-06-01 13:35:43
原创
1140 人浏览过

bitsCN.com

mysql权限管理,一个非db管理员创建mysql的做法

 

安装了mysql,建了数据库,需要几个账号,进行权限管理,现总结如下

 

一个建了四个账号。

1.    root 账号,这是安装数据库时设置的,假设账号密码如下:

 

root  passwd

 

此账号具有管理数据库的最高权限,可以创建用户,建数据库,修改表等全部权限

 

2.    第二个账户  www.bitsCN.com  

 

create passwd

 

此账户具有对特定数据库操作的全部权限

 

grant all on db_name to create@'%' identified by 'passwd';

 

其中'%'代表creat账户可以从任意主机连接此数据库都可有此权限

 

3. 第三个账户

 

db_write passwd

 

对特定数据库写权限账户

 

grant select,update,delete,insert on db_name to db_write@'%' identified by 'passwd';

 

4.第四个账户

 

db_read passwd

 

对特定数据库读权限账户

 

grant select on db_name to db_read@'%' identified by 'passwd';

 

bitsCN.com
来源:php.cn
本站声明
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系admin@php.cn
最新问题
@管理员 能不能申请成为站内的管理员啊
来自于 1970-01-01 08:00:00
0
0
0
@管理员 能不能申请成为站内管理员啊
来自于 1970-01-01 08:00:00
0
0
0
管理员重复登录?
来自于 1970-01-01 08:00:00
0
0
0
管理员账户密码都不修改,
来自于 1970-01-01 08:00:00
0
0
0
管理员添加问题
来自于 1970-01-01 08:00:00
0
0
0
热门教程
更多>
最新下载
更多>
网站特效
网站源码
网站素材
前端模板